📋 Core Type Categories
Container Types
- Container: Container configuration and state
- Image: Image metadata and configuration
- Volume: Volume definitions and management
- Network: Network configuration and state
- Exec: Execution parameters and results
Kubernetes Types
- Pod: Pod definitions and status
- Deployment: Deployment configurations
- Service: Service definitions and endpoints
- ConfigMap: Configuration data
- Secret: Sensitive data management
API Types
- Request: API request models
- Response: API response models
- Event: Event data structures
- Filter: Filtering parameters
- Pagination: Pagination support
Error Types
- DockerError: Docker-specific error types
- KubernetesError: Kubernetes-specific error types
- NetworkError: Network-related errors
- StorageError: Storage-related errors
- ValidationError: Data validation errors
